I was in his pits yesterday when he fired it up for the first time about three o'clock. He said Tuesday he got the call from NHRA to tell him he was in and at that time the car was sitting in the back corner of his shop with no engine, tranny, or computer. The RacPak came in Wednesday and he got the engine from Steve Schmidt on Thursday. So they have pretty much been building the car at the track. Yesterday was the first time he let the clutch out and it went a 6.79 with some tire shake and a bad clutch switch which was turning on the 2 step through out the run. Today in the second round he went a 6.75 and he hasn't even started tuning on the engine yet. He said he knew it was fat but without the O2's hooked up he didn't know how much. Last night he said that he would have been happy with a 6.83 to a 6.85 for the weekend so he was happy with the 6.79.
